So, the baby is due on Tuesday (officially) and we’re really excited about meeting the new addition to our family and finding out whether Leo will have a newborn brother or sister…

I want to write a bit about my experiences at Virgin Active Health Club about exercising whilst pregnant as it’s something that I’ve been regularly doing and have enjoyed thoroughly…

The later stages of the pregnancy

I’ve been a bit tired recently so haven’t been going to Virgin Active quite as regularly as I would have liked to. However the work I have put into training during this pregnancy has really benefited my fitness levels and I feel so much more active compared to my last pregnancy. I have less aches and pains and I’m on the go a lot more running around after our 3 year old and generally not feeling the need to take it too easy. In terms of how I look, most of the weight has gone straight onto the bump as opposed to elsewhere on my body.

Working out whilst pregnant

To be honest the pregnancy has been a breeze physically, and I do put this largely down to exercising during trimesters 2 and 3. I’ve also been working with a Virgin Active antenatal specialist personal trainer regularly throughout this time which has been invaluable to keeping me on track, motivating me and showing me what pieces of gym equipment are safe for me to be using (and believe me there are lots to choose from! I’ve been pleasantly surprised as to how much I can safely do in the gym, in fact.

Weight gain

Although the bump is definitely a little bigger this time, the weight gain has been exactly the same and I’ve gained exactly 2 stones each time.

Other people’s reactions

It’s been an interesting experience going to the gym with a bump. It’s a pretty rare sight – I’ve not spotted any other obviously pregnant women in there that I recall. I’ve had lots of women approach me after a training session, usually in the changing rooms saying how great it is that I’m training and commenting on the bump etc. I’ve had women telling me their experiences of going to the gym throughout their pregnancies right up until their labors and how they feel this helped them during the birth and postnatally.

Would I recommend attending a gym whilst pregnant?

Absolutely! Although for me doing so in the first trimester wasn’t overly appealing due to the increased risk of miscarriage at this time. However, the second and third trimesters have been so much easier as a result of exercising. I think that there is a lot of fear around this concept largely due to lack of knowledge. Guys especially in the gym have glanced over when I’ve been working out hard with really concerned expressions on their faces. But I think the trick is to stay as active as possible during the pregnancy and do as much research as possible about what is safe to do throughout the different stages.  For me, the key is to remember that pregnancy is a natural process and NOT an illness, therefore why stop everything just because you’re growing a baby?
